Tagalog[edit]

Pronunciation[edit]

Noun[edit]

yukyók (Baybayin spelling ᜌᜓᜃ᜔ᜌᜓᜃ᜔)

  1. crouching or squatting position
    Synonym: pagyukyok
    Ginagawa ang yukyok sa ibaba ng mesa kapag lumilindol.
    Crouching under a table is done when there is an earthquake.
  2. cowering; crouching in fear (as of animals)
    Synonym: pagyukyok
    Tumutuloy pa rin ang aso sa yukyok sa sulok dahil sa pamamalo ng kanyang may-ari.
    The dog is still doing some cowering in the corner because of his owner's beating.
  3. sunken condition (of a loose pile of soil, garbage, etc.)
    Synonyms: pagkaukok, kaukukan
  4. gradual fall or sinking (of a loose pile of soil, garbage, etc.)
    Synonyms: ukok, pag-ukok
